I fly my own plane the same way that I flew rental planes. Every
so often, Rick and I would try to do some basic maneuvers such as slow flight, steep turns, stalls, soft and short field landings. We have the tires and brakes replaced about every 250 or so hours. I have no ideas how much money we would have saved if we had 'babied' our plane. IMHO, being proficient at short field landings may save my skin someday and no amount of money is worth my life. Oh, we practice all the other stuff -- but short-short-short field landings are NOT one of them. Botching a power-off, let's-plant-it-on- the-numbers landing is just too potentially expensive, since Atlas' nose will slam down like Thor's hammer if you let him get too slow. Which isn't to say we shy away from short fields. We routinely fly into 2200 foot grass strips, so we're fairly proficient at it. -- Jay Honeck Iowa City, IA Pathfinder N56993 www.AlexisParkInn.com "Your Aviation Destination" |
